Morning Somewhere put out a podcast on August 7th detailing the relaunch of the RT website. A summary of the relevant information:
The website is now fully open to the public. Everything from the Rooster Teeth archives should be back up and available, including most RvB content.
Rooster Teeth's community site and forums, that were started in 2004 and shut down in 2018, are now back up. All of the old profiles and posts are set to private by default. If you remember your log in credentials you can access all of your old profile and, if you'd like, make it public again.
The old comments sections are also back up and have new sorting capabilities.
The "First" model is gone. The "Sponsor" model is back.
They have been doing a lot of work on removing Red vs Blue from behind the paywall. The show will be available on both the RT site and on Youtube. They're still in the process of getting all of the seasons out, though what exactly that process entails is never clarified. As of August 10th, only seasons 1-14 are available to the public.
The individual episodes of each season are (or will be) available publicly, while the Complete series (the versions that condense the whole of a season into just 1-3 videos) are still going to be kept behind the Youtube memberships/RT site sponsorships. Note that the Complete mini-series have always stayed available publicly.
Not said on the podcast, but Restoration is not up on the site at all, not even for sponsors. It still can only be watched through external purchase.
As also said in their February 9th podcast, they are very certain of the stability of the future of RT and the availability of this content going forward. Archival has always been a major focus of their relaunch.
